Job description

Job Summary:

The Department of Neurosurgery at Westchester Medical Center is seeking a board eligible/board certified neurosurgeon with strong training in both cranial and spine surgery. The candidate would be integral to the further expansion of a rapidly growing academic Neurosurgical department into the western part of our health network. The Department has an excellent collaborative relationship with Orthopedics,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ation, Neurology, and an integrated Pain Management practice. The department also has significant institutional resources for both inpatient and outpatient growth allocated by hospital administration including a newly constructed outpatient pavilion, ambulatory surgery center, Globus ExcelsiusGPStm robot, Medtronic O-arm spinal navigation system, and Zeiss microscopes. The ideal candidate must possess a strong interest in clinical care, teaching, research, and programmatic development. Subspecialty interests will be strongly supported. Candidates are expected to be able to obtain an active New York medical license.

Responsibilities:

Responsibilities include maintaining a productive community-based surgical practice in cranial and spinal disease, teaching and mentoring neurosurgical residents, and advancing knowledge in the field through publication and best practices in patient care. Pursuit of individual research endeavors will be well-supported.

Additional Benefits:

WMC Health offers a generous compensation package with performance and quality measures. In addition, we offer exceptional work/life balance, a comprehensive benefits package, malpractice insurance, paid vacation, and a generous stipend for Continuing Medical Education - including paid time off.

Facility Info:

As a teaching hospital of New York Medical College, the candidate will have close interaction with the program's fellows, residents, and medical students. With a collegial atmosphere, educational opportunities will be available at both the Westchester Medical Center and MidHudson Regional Hospital campuses.
